Event Description: The Young WFPHA (World Federation of Public Health Associations) is a network that unites early-career public health professionals and students. Its primary objective is to promote collaboration, networking, and leadership development among students and young professionals in the public health field. The mission of the network is to provide a platform for discussion, support, and advocacy, enabling early-career public health professionals across the globe to share knowledge, experiences and opportunities. The vision is to empower and engage the next generation of public health leaders to create a healthier and more equitable world. This will be achieved by promoting various opportunities for training, research, mentoring programs, networking, skill-building, and facilitating the exchange of knowledge and best practices across regions and disciplines.

Young WFPHA recognizes the importance of young people’s perspectives and voices in shaping public health policy at both the national and international levels. It seeks to represent and empower young people in decision-making processes and ensure that they have a say in the global public health discourse. In this regard, Young WFPHA has representation inside the WHO Youth Council (WHO YC), specifically attending to the Mental Health and NCDs Working group. The goal is to become an official member of the WHO YC within the next two years.

Event Description: We are living in the Anthropocene, the era in which the earth is being shaped by human activity. We are facing not only climate change, but also declining of biodiversity, shortages of fertile land and fresh water, changing in biogeochemical cycles, increased risk of infectious diseases, and the accumulation of new entities not previously present in nature. Education plays a key role in addressing this situation. In particular, the education of future doctors must provide the knowledge to interpret the complexity of the global situation and must provide the tools to think of the health of humanity as inextricably linked to the health of the planet. The question that must therefore be asked is: how should Planetary health be incorporated into medical curricula?

Event Description: The Municipality of Lisbon (CML) has around 10,000 workers. Being a large and stable population, part of the biggest city in Portugal, it is good setting for the development of health promotion activities for capacity building of the population aiming at empowering our communities with health literacy.

The Department of Health, Hygiene and Safety (DSHS) has an extensive team of health and occupational safety technicians and occupational physicians, nurses, nutritionists, cardiopneumologists, and occupational psychologists. This department collaborates closely with Lisbon Universities to further develop research on the wellbeing of their employees and subsequently of the population of the municipality.

To celebrate the Global Public Health Week, the DSHS and NOVA Medical School will together enhance and promote one of their regular activities: the practice of physical activity, mobility and stretches during working hours. This initiative, named active pauses during the day is part of a bigger project “100% Health and Wellbeing”, which is aligned with the view of the Municipality Great Plan Options 2022-2026, following the Sustainable Development Goals. This Public Health Campaign, aligned with your initiative from WFPHA will help the workers population to understand how important it is to care for their own health, aiming to recall the population’s attention for their overall health and wellbeing. Chi Kung classes are offered at diverse locations, 17 times per week, at several locations of the institution. Its practice is proven to minimize posture bad habits, to prevent fatigue, to prevent low back pain, to improve wellbeing and joyful emotions.
